Q: Is 3,779,265 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 3,779,265 is a composite number.

Why is 3,779,265 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 3,779,265 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 7 15 21 35 105 35,993 107,979 179,965 251,951 539,895 755,853 1,259,755 and 3,779,265, with no remainder.

Since 3,779,265 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,779,265, it is a composite number.
